MEC 235 - Instrumentation II Electrical


3 Credit(s)
Instrumentation II Electrical is an introduction to the field of process control using electrical basic devices for measuring and controlling different kinds of variables in process control. The course shall deal with areas that will explain the role of instrumentation electrically in a closed-loop control and PID functions. Students will work with analog and digital devices and programmable logic controllers (PLCs). This course will cover thermal measurement and operation of RTDs, thermistors, and thermocouples and thermometers, as well as pressure, flow, and level equipment and controls. Discussion on calibration standards, typical calibrating methods, and instrument testing will also be included.

Prerequisite(s): APT 155 .
